Watch your thoughts; they become words.
Watch your words; they become actions.
Watch your actions; they become habits.
Watch your habits; they become character.
Watch your character; it becomes your destiny.
– Frank Outlaw
“Frank Outlaw” doesn’t seem to exist. The quotation is attributed here to “Elizabeth C.”
Here is another, more poetic variation found at Quoteland.com:
